US Flight School Looking to Expand Partnerships with Colleges and Universities

28th Jul 2022

US Flight School Revv Aviation is looking to expand offering flight services to existing and up-and-coming Part 141 aviation programs at two- and four-year secondary education institutions.

“We have 33 years of flight training experience, and 15 years as the flight service provider for the University of Nebraska-Omaha Aviation Institute’s degreed aviation programs,” said Lisa LaMantia, chief operating officer for Revv Aviation.

Revv has more than 2,000 flight school graduates earning certifications from private pilot license to Airline Transport Pilot. In the past 12 months, more than 20 Revv students have been hired by regional airlines. Revv has established programs with SkyWest and Envoy.

Community colleges, technical schools and universities are looking for programs that will fill immediate career gaps, and aviation is an industry that is in dire need of pilots, mechanics, avionics technicians and line crew.

“We can work with institutions on an FAA-approved Part 141 flight curriculum that they can quickly implement in order to draw additional students to their schools,” said LaMantia.

More than 150 students are enrolled in the UNO Aviation Institute, are completing their flight requirements with Revv Aviation in Council Bluffs and at Eppley Airfield in Omaha.

“We have enjoyed working with Lisa and Revv Aviation for a number of years,” said Scott Vlasek, director of the UNO Aviation Institute. “As one of our approved flight training providers, they provide our students with exceptional training and a commitment to safety and our students’ well-being. The relationship between Revv Aviation and the UNO Aviation Institute is one built on safety, student focus, and a commitment to working with each other. Revv Aviation is a great partner, and I would be happy to speak with anyone interested in building a relationship with them.”

Revv has several offerings that benefit people in aviation.

• Its pilot training is VA-approved, which is a benefit for students on the GI Bill as well as for those who have rotorcraft experience and want fixed-wing certification as well

  • Second-in-command (SIC) charter pilot positions are open to its flight instructors for career advancement
  • It offers CFI opportunities for Chief / Assistant / Stage Check / Aerobatic Instructor positions
  • More than 50 training aircraft and 40 certified flight instructors across our nine flight school locations – Aurora and Schaumburg, Ill.; Janesville, Wisconsin.; Council Bluffs, Davenport, Muscatine and Sioux City, Iowa; Omaha, Nebraska.; and Huron, South Dakota.
